Intel Xeon w9-3475X Benchmark, Test and specs

Last updated:
The Intel Xeon w9-3475X has 36 cores with 72 threads and is based on the 12. gen of the Intel Xeon W series. The processor uses a mainboard with the LGA 4677 socket and was released in Q1/2023. The Intel Xeon w9-3475X scores 1,814 points in the Geekbench 5 single-core benchmark. In the Geekbench 5 multi-core benchmark, the result is 44,869 points.

CPU Cores and Base Frequency

The Intel Xeon w9-3475X has 36 CPU cores and can calculate 72 threads in parallel. The clock frequency of the Intel Xeon w9-3475X is 2.20 GHz (4.80 GHz). The number of CPU cores greatly affects the speed of the processor and is an important performance indicator.

CPU Cores / Threads: 36 / 72
Core architecture: normal
Cores: 36x
Hyperthreading / SMT: Yes
Overclocking: Yes
Frequency: 2.20 GHz
Turbo Frequency (1 Core): 4.80 GHz
Turbo Frequency (36 Cores): 3.00 GHz

Memory & PCIe

The processor can use up to 4096 GB memory in 8 (Octa Channel) memory channels. The maximum memory bandwidth is 307.2 GB/s. The memory type as well as the amount of memory can greatly affect the speed of the system.

Memory type: DDR5-4800
Max. Memory: 4096 GB
Memory channels: 8 (Octa Channel)
Bandwidth: 307.2 GB/s
ECC: Yes
PCIe: 5.0 x 112
AES-NI: Yes

Thermal Management

The thermal design power (TDP for short) of the processor is 300 W. The TDP specifies the necessary cooling solution that is required to cool the processor sufficiently. The TDP usually gives a rough idea of the actual power consumption of the CPU.

TDP (PL1 / PBP): 300 W
TDP (PL2): --
TDP up: 360 W
TDP down: --
Tjunction max.: 95 °C

Technical details

The Intel Xeon w9-3475X is made in 10 nm. The smaller the manufacturing process of a CPU, the more modern and energy-efficient it is. Overall, the processor has 82.50 MB cache. A large cache can greatly speed up the processor's speed in some cases such as games.

Technology: 10 nm
Chip design: Monolithic
Socket: LGA 4677
L2-Cache: --
L3-Cache: 82.50 MB
Architecture: Sapphire Rapids-WS
Operating systems: Windows 11, Windows Server, Linux
Virtualization: VT-x, VT-x EPT, VT-d, VT-rp, vPro Enterprise
Instruction set (ISA): x86-64 (64 bit)
ISA extensions: SSE4.1, SSE4.2, AVX2, AVX-512, AMX
Release date: Q1/2023
Release price: 3739 $
